The Importance of Economic Growth in Modern Society

Economic growth plays a vital role in shaping the well-being and prosperity of nations. It refers to the increase in the production of goods and services over a period, and it is a key indicator of a country's development and stability. When an economy grows, it leads to higher employment rates, improved living standards, and increased government revenues, allowing for better public services like education, healthcare, and infrastructure.

A strong economic foundation helps nations invest in technological innovation, enhancing productivity across various sectors. Economic advancements also lead to higher disposable incomes, which drive consumer spending and further stimulate business expansion. This creates a positive cycle of growth and opportunity, attracting both local and international investments.

However, economic growth must be sustainable. Rapid industrialization without consideration for environmental impacts can lead to problems like pollution and resource depletion. Therefore, modern economic strategies focus on balancing growth with ecological responsibility, promoting green technologies and sustainable business practices.

Governments and policymakers often implement reforms to stimulate economic growth. These include tax incentives, investment in education and workforce training, infrastructure development, and support for small and medium-sized enterprises. Additionally, trade agreements and globalization have opened new markets, creating further opportunities for economic development.

Economic resilience is also critical. Events such as financial crises, pandemics, or political instability can disrupt growth. Building a diversified economy, encouraging innovation, and maintaining strong financial institutions are essential steps toward achieving long-term economic security.

In conclusion, economic progress is not just about higher numbers on a financial chart; it is about improving the quality of life for all citizens. A healthy economy supports strong communities, encourages innovation, and lays the groundwork for a more prosperous future.
